Severe weather conditions across Texas have resulted in significant travel disruption, with nearly 150 flights either cancelled or delayed at Dallas Fort Worth International Airport alone. The storms have prompted flash flood warnings and led to school closures in affected areas, as residents are urged to take precautions against the hazardous conditions. This volatile weather front is sweeping across the state, bringing heavy rainfall and strong winds, creating challenging circumstances for commuters and local services.
Simultaneously, the north-eastern United States has been grappling with an intense heatwave, pushing temperatures to record-breaking highs. This period of extreme heat has placed considerable strain on infrastructure and public health services, with authorities issuing warnings and advice to the public on staying safe. However, a dramatic shift in weather patterns is now anticipated, with forecasts indicating a significant cool-down for the region following this period of oppressive heat.
